So, my question is: should I go for the 2.5" disk setup or 3.5" disk setup, and does the raid setup in either case look correct?

Afaik they are about equal in speed. With the smaller ones being a bit faster in random access and the larger ones a bit faster for sequential reads/writes.

My guess is that the 8x 2.5" configuration will be faster than the 6x 3.5", even if the 3.5"-drives happen to be faster they probably aren't 50% faster... So since you don't need the larger storage capacities that 3.5" offer, I'd go with the 8x 2.5"-setup.
